summ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orJean-Baptiste Queru <jbq@google.com>2012-06-22 13:47:39 -0700
committerandroid code review <noreply-gerritcodereview@google.com>2012-06-22 13:47:40 -0700
commitee41897222ece3b5afeed00c638905111ccabc2e (patch)
treeea5870ef8d7454c20b607da5da29152fbe7eefd3
parent247cca233d5fa774a42e4137413d4fa8bcb66482 (diff)
parent8ed2c41a14a0adf71c9bb8643753f52c927bb2e2 (diff)
downloadMms-ee41897222ece3b5afeed00c638905111ccabc2e.tar.gz
Merge "Mms: Take Ellipsis also in to consideration when comparing width"ics-plus-aosp
-rw-r--r--src/com/android/mms/ui/SearchActivity.java5
1 files changed, 3 insertions, 2 deletions
diff --git a/src/com/android/mms/ui/SearchActivity.java b/src/com/android/mms/ui/SearchActivity.java
index e7bfcb08..e584cb2e 100644
--- a/src/com/android/mms/ui/SearchActivity.java
+++ b/src/com/android/mms/ui/SearchActivity.java
@@ -117,12 +117,13 @@ public class SearchActivity extends ListActivity
float searchStringWidth = tp.measureText(mTargetString);
float textFieldWidth = getWidth();
+ float ellipsisWidth = tp.measureText(sEllipsis);
+ textFieldWidth -= (2F * ellipsisWidth); // assume we'll need one on both ends
+
String snippetString = null;
if (searchStringWidth > textFieldWidth) {
snippetString = mFullText.substring(startPos, startPos + searchStringLength);
} else {
- float ellipsisWidth = tp.measureText(sEllipsis);
- textFieldWidth -= (2F * ellipsisWidth); // assume we'll need one on both ends
int offset = -1;
int start = -1;